The Corporation of The Town Of Essex
By-Law Number 314
A by-law for requiring owners of privately
Owned outdoor swimming pools to erect and maintain fences and
gates around such swimming pools and for prescribing the height and
description of, and the manner of erecting and maintaining such fences
and gates.
Whereas the Municipal Council of the Corporation of the Town of Essex has deemed it
advisable to pass this By-Law pursuant to the provisions of the Municipal Act, R.S.O.
1990, Chapter 302, Section 210, Paragraph 30, and all amendments thereto;
Now therefore the municipal Council of the Corporation of the Town of Essex enacts
as follows:
1.
In this by-law "Swimming Pool" shall mean any artificially constructed pool
designed for bathing purposes and without limiting the generality of the
foregoing, shall mean pool above or below ground level, or partly above and
partly below ground level capable of being filled with water to a depth of sixty
centimeters (60 cm) or more.
2.
No person shall maintain a privately owned outdoor swimming pool within the
Corporate limits of the Town of Essex unless such pool or the land or a part of
the land on which such pool is located is effectively fenced and/or enclosed in
accordance with the following provisions:
a)
Every fence shall be not less than one hundred and twenty centimeters
(120 cm) in height.
b)
Every fence shall be so constructed that all horizontal or diagonal
structural members of the fence shall be located on the inside or
poolside of the fence.
c)
Every fence shall be so constructed that it cannot be used in a manner
similar to a ladder.
d)
A dwelling, house, building or accessory building may be utilized to
effectively enclose any pool.
e)
Every fence shall be so constructed so as to have the only means of
access to the pool by gates and/or doors provided that:
(i)
All gates and doors shall be equipped with a self-closing device
and a self-latching device on the side nearest the pool at the top
of the gate to the intent that all gates or doors will remain
securely closed when the pool is not in use.
(ii)
Each gate must be equipped with a lock and each gate must be
locked when the pool is not in use.
(iii)
Part (i) shall not apply to the door of any dwelling house which
forms part of the enclosure.
(iv)
Where a swimming pool is located above the ground and has
sides of 1.2 metres (4 feet) in height or greater, a fence of the
above specifications shall not be required except to enclose any
appurtenances to the pool such as filter arrangement, decks,
stairs or entrance ladders.
f)
The use of barbed wire in any manner, or any device for projecting an
electric current in connection with or through any such perimeter fence
is prohibited.
3.
No person shall erect or maintain, or cause to be erected or maintained within
nine metres (9m) of any roadway intersection, any fence more than seventy
centimeters (70cm) in height above the grade level of the roadway, unless the
portion exceeding seventy centimeters (70cm) in height is built of wire only
and does not obstruct the view of persons approaching such intersection.
4.
The provisions of this by-law shall apply to all privately owned outdoor
swimming pools regardless of the date of construction of such swimming pool.
5.
Every person who contravenes any provisions of this By-Law is guilty of an
offence and on conviction is liable to a fine as provided for in the Provincial
Offences Act.
6.
By-Law number 188 is hereby repealed.
7.
This By-Law shall come into force and take effect on the date of final passing
thereof.

Town of Essex By-Law Number 314
A by-law for requiring the owners of privately owned swimming pools in the Town of Essex to erect and maintain fences
and gates around such swimming pools.
Item
Column 1
Short Form Wording
Column 2
Offence creating provision or defining
offence
Column 3
Set Fine
(Including costs)
1.
Fail to properly fence/enclose privately owned
swimming pool
2
$105.00
2.
Erect/cause to be erected improper fence within 9
metres of roadway intersection
3
$105.00
3.
Maintain/caused to be maintained improper fence
within 9 metres of roadway intersection
3
$105.00
Note: The penalty provision(s) for the offences indicated above is Section 5 of By-Law Number 314, as Amended, a certified copy of which has been filed.
